What is Cavco Industries LT-Debt-to-Total-Asset?

Cavco Industries CVCO -0.63% 96 LT-Debt-to-Total-Asset is 0.02 as of Mar. 2026. GuruFocus rates CVCO with a GF Score™ of 96/100 and a GF Value™ of $535.12 (Modestly Overvalued). The stock has 1 warning sign investors should review.

LT Debt to Total Assets is a measurement representing the percentage of a corporation's assets that are financed with loans and financial obligations lasting more than one year. The ratio provides a general measure of the financial position of a company, including its ability to meet financial requirements for outstanding loans. It is calculated as a company's Long-Term Debt & Capital Lease Obligationdivide by its Total Assets. Cavco Industries's long-term debt to total assests ratio for the quarter that ended in Mar. 2026 was 0.02.

Cavco Industries's long-term debt to total assets ratio declined from Mar. 2025 (0.02) to Mar. 2026 (0.02). It may suggest that Cavco Industries is progressively becoming less dependent on debt to grow their business.

Cavco Industries LT-Debt-to-Total-Asset Calculation

Cavco Industries's Long-Term Debt to Total Asset Ratio for the fiscal year that ended in Mar. 2026 is calculated as

LT Debt to Total Assets (A: Mar. 2026 )=Long-Term Debt & Capital Lease Obligation (A: Mar. 2026 )/Total Assets (A: Mar. 2026 )
=30.747/1491.139
=0.02

Cavco Industries's Long-Term Debt to Total Asset Ratio for the quarter that ended in Mar. 2026 is calculated as

LT Debt to Total Assets (Q: Mar. 2026 )=Long-Term Debt & Capital Lease Obligation (Q: Mar. 2026 )/Total Assets (Q: Mar. 2026 )
=30.747/1491.139
=0.02

Cavco Industries Business Description

Address 3636 North Central Avenue, Suite 1200, Phoenix, AZ, USA, 85012
Cavco Industries Inc designs and produces factory-built homes distributed through a network of independent and company-owned retailers, planned community operators and residential developers. It is also a producer of park model RVs, vacation cabins and Factory-built commercial structures. It operates principally in two segments: factory-built housing, which includes wholesale and retail factory-built housing operations and Financial services, which include manufactured housing consumer finance and insurance. The factory-built housing segment generates the majority of revenue from building and selling manufactured and modular homes to both wholesale customers and end consumers through company owned retail stores.
